/// <summary>
/// Use to retrieve the contents of a text file under version control.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// Puts the content of the specified file in a temporary file. The caller is responsible for deleting the file.
/// </remarks>
/// <param name="eid">The file's element ID.</param>
/// <param name="depot">The depot.</param>
/// <param name="ver_spec">The version specification in the numeric or text format, e.g. \c 32/1 or \c PG_MAINT1_barnyrd\4.</param>
/// <returns>A string initialized to the name of the temporary file with the contents from the
/// AccuRev <tt>cat -v \<ver_spec\> -p \<depot\> -e \<eid\></tt> command on success, otherwise \e null on error.
/// </returns>
/*! \cat_ <tt>cat -v \<ver_spec\> -p \<depot\> -e \<eid\></tt> */
/// <exception cref="AcUtilsException">caught and [logged](@ref AcUtils#AcDebug#initAcLogging)
/// in <tt>\%LOCALAPPDATA\%\\AcTools\\Logs\\<prog_name\>-YYYY-MM-DD.log</tt> on \c cat command failure.</exception>
/// <exception cref="Exception">caught and logged in same on failure to handle a range of exceptions.</exception>
/*! \accunote_ The CLI \c cat command fails on Windows for ptext files larger than 62,733 bytes. Fixed in 6.0. AccuRev defect 28177. */
/*! \accunote_ For the \c name, \c anc and \c cat commands, the validity of the results is guaranteed only if the commands are issued outside a workspace, or in a workspace whose
backing stream is in the same depot for both workspace and the <tt>-v \<ver_spec\></tt> option used. If issued from a workspace that has a different backing stream than
the <tt>-v \<ver_spec\></tt>, provided both workspace and ver_spec share the same depot, the command results can be deemed valid. However, if issued from a workspace whose
backing stream is in a different depot than the <tt>-v \<ver_spec\></tt>, the command results are invalid. Applications should set the default directory to a non-workspace
location prior to issuing these commands. AccuRev defects 18080, 21469, 1097778. */
public static async Task<string> getCatFileAsync(int eid, AcDepot depot, string ver_spec)
{
string tmpFile = null;
try
{
AcResult r = await AcCommand.runAsync($@"cat -v ""{ver_spec}"" -p ""{depot}"" -e {eid}")
.ConfigureAwait(false);
if (r != null && r.RetVal == 0)
{
tmpFile = Path.GetTempFileName();
using (StreamWriter streamWriter = new StreamWriter(tmpFile))
{
streamWriter.Write(r.CmdResult);
}
}
}
catch (AcUtilsException ecx)
{
AcDebug.Log($"AcUtilsException caught and logged in AcQuery.getCatFileAsync{Environment.NewLine}{ecx.Message}");
}
catch (Exception ecx) // IOException, DirectoryNotFoundException, PathTooLongException, SecurityException... others
{
AcDebug.Log($"Exception caught and logged in AcQuery.getCatFileAsync{Environment.NewLine}{ecx.Message}");
}
return tmpFile;
}

/// <summary>
/// Get the depot-relative path for the element in \e stream with \e EID.
/// Also returns the element's parent folder EID (folder where the element resides).
/// </summary>
/// <param name="stream">Name of the stream where the element resides.</param>
/// <param name="EID">The element ID of the element on which to query.</param>
/// <returns>An tuple initialized as <em>{depot-relative path, parent EID}</em> on success, otherwise \e null.</returns>
/*! \name_ <tt>name -v \<stream\> -fx -e \<EID\></tt> */
/// <exception cref="AcUtilsException">caught and [logged](@ref AcUtils#AcDebug#initAcLogging)
/// in <tt>\%LOCALAPPDATA\%\\AcTools\\Logs\\<prog_name\>-YYYY-MM-DD.log</tt> on \c name command failure.</exception>
/// <exception cref="Exception">caught and logged in same on failure to handle a range of exceptions.</exception>
/*! \code
accurev name -v MARS_MAINT2 -fx -e 13763
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<AcResponse
Command="name"
TaskId="51498">
<element
location="\.\scripts\build.xml"
parent_id="12269"/>
</AcResponse>
\endcode */
/*! \accunote_ For the \c name, \c anc and \c cat commands, the validity of the results is guaranteed only if the commands are issued outside a workspace, or in a workspace whose
backing stream is in the same depot for both workspace and the <tt>-v \<ver_spec\></tt> option used. If issued from a workspace that has a different backing stream than
the <tt>-v \<ver_spec\></tt>, provided both workspace and ver_spec share the same depot, the command results can be deemed valid. However, if issued from a workspace whose
backing stream is in a different depot than the <tt>-v \<ver_spec\></tt>, the command results are invalid. Applications should set the default directory to a non-workspace
location prior to issuing these commands. AccuRev defects 18080, 21469, 1097778. */
public static async Task<Tuple<string, int>> getElementNameAsync(string stream, int EID)
{
Tuple<string, int> ret = null; // depot-relative path, parent folder EID
try
{
AcResult r = await AcCommand.runAsync($@"name -v ""{stream}"" -fx -e {EID}").ConfigureAwait(false);
if (r != null && r.RetVal == 0)
{
XElement xml = XElement.Parse(r.CmdResult);
string location = (string)xml.Element("element").Attribute("location");
int parent_id = (int)xml.Element("element").Attribute("parent_id");
ret = Tuple.Create(location, parent_id);
}
}
catch (AcUtilsException ecx)
{
AcDebug.Log($"AcUtilsException caught and logged in AcQuery.getElementNameAsync{Environment.NewLine}{ecx.Message}");
}
catch (Exception ecx)
{
AcDebug.Log($"Exception caught and logged in AcQuery.getElementNameAsync{Environment.NewLine}{ecx.Message}");
}
return ret;
}
